About the Item

This Federal Cherrywood Bureau cabinet dates to 1790. It is a beautifully preserved example of early American Federal craftsmanship. The piece combines graceful proportions, warm patinated surfaces, and practical interior storage--embodying both the elegance and utility priced during the early Federal period. The upper section features paneled cabinet doors with original or period appropriate brass escutcheons opening to generous interior storage. Below, the slant-front desk folds down to reveal a richly finished writing surface surrounded by an arrangement of small drawers, pigeonholes, and cubbies. The lower case consists of four graduated drawers, each retaining its handsome oval brass pulls and original keyhole surrounds. The cabinet stands on shaped French feet with a delicately scalloped apron, lending a lightness to the otherwise robust form. Made of solid cherrywood throughout, the surface has developed a rich, warm tone that only centuries of careful use can create.
